Real-Time Fracture Add-on User Guide
Access: The Real-Time Fracture add-on can be found under Blender's N Panel.
Usage Steps
1. Object Selection
- Select a mesh or a curve object with volume.
- Press the Start Fracture button to fracture the selected objects.
- You can perform bulk fracturing by selecting multiple objects at once.
2. Working on Existing Fractures
To edit a previously fractured object, select the relevant object from the Fractured Object list.
3. Boolean Type Selection
- Blender Default Boolean: Fast but may produce errors with complex objects.
- Remesh Boolean: Slower but provides more stable results for complex objects.
4. Scatter Points Settings
- Uniform Scatter Points: Provides an even distribution within the bounding box.
- Axis-Based Scatter Points: Distributes points based on X, Y, Z axes.
- Radial Scatter Points: Creates circular layers radiating outward from the center.
-
Manual Scatter Points: Places points based on an external selected object.
- For manual distribution with multiple objects, select the Collection type.
- The surface or volume of the selected object can be used to generate points. Enable the Use Volume option to create a volume-based distribution.
5. Cell Settings
- Cell Relax: Smooths the Voronoi distribution.
- Cell Margin: Adjusts the spacing between fragments.
- Cell Noise: Increases irregularity in point placement for a more natural appearance.
6. Subdiv & Displacement Settings
Adds high resolution and detail to fractured objects.
- Enhances the detail of inner and edge surfaces.
- When increasing values, adjust by increments of 1 unit or enter a specific value and press Enter. Dragging with the mouse may cause excessive computational load.
7. Rigid Body Dynamics (RBD) Settings
- Customize physics settings such as Deactivation, Activator object selection, Mass multiplier, Friction, and Bounciness.
- The Activator object should be either a passive or active RBD object.
- You can activate fragments by animating the activator object or enable automatic activation through RBD physics.
- Multiple activator objects can be selected for a fracture group.
- Use the Picker tool to add multiple activator objects and adjust the effect range using the threshold setting. Calculations will be performed automatically.
8. Clusters & Constraints
- Add Clusters to a fracture group to create Constraints between fragments.
- You can edit physics settings for the generated Clusters by selecting them.
- Each Fracture group, Clusters, and Constraints are stored in separate Collections, which can be manually selected and edited.
